Monday 24 October 1988 — SYDNEY

The Nine Network screens the second and final part of the mini-series Barlow And Chambers: A Long Way From Home. The series told the real life story of Australians Kevin Barlow and Geoffrey Chambers — both convicted and sentenced to death for heroin possession in Malaysia. Cast included Hugo Weaving and John Polson and international stars Julie Christie and Sarah Jessica Parker.
